A welcome from Pastor Inger

Thank you for checking out our website! 

Are you interested in a church that feels like family? Where children are invited into worship and where people gather several times a week to laugh, eat, and study together? We would love for you to visit us: we worship at 11:00am each Sunday, with Sunday School at 10:00am. Once a month, we have Messy Church where children gather to play games, make a craft and learn a Bible story on a Sunday evening. We believe in doing things together as a church family, whether that means our very famous potluck lunches (those women can cook!), field trips to Shelton Fall Festival or Concerts on the Green, Christmas parties, community playgroup, or s'mores get togethers to name just a few of the fun things we do.

We also believe in reaching out beyond ourselves. Twice a year we have a large barbeque that is well known in these parts. All profits go to support missions in our community. We also host Boy Scout, Girl Scout and Cub Scout troops, organize blood drives, work in the Mooresville Soup Kitchen, and support backpack ministries as ways to be God's people in our world.

What's so nice about our small size is that you can come in and either choose to be filled and quietly take it all in or to get involved and really make a difference. We all have seasons in our lives for both. 

So is God calling you to explore Fieldstone as your church home? We hope so! Come and See!
